Midjourney pauses free trials
Yep, more about AI! According to The Verge, Midjourney — a wildly popular AI image generator — has stopped free trials for its services, citing “extraordinary demand and trial abuse”. The pause to free trials comes after deepfake images generated through Midjourney have gone viral, including images of Trump getting arrested.
Tech sector shocked by SVB collapse
The sudden collapse of Silicon Valley Bank — which served primarily tech start-ups and venture capitalists — sent shockwaves through the tech industry earlier this month. With raising capital already a struggle given the recent economic climate, the collapse leaves a gaping hole for the tech industry which had relied on it to provide services to fast-growing ventures, according to the Washington Post. It is the second-largest bank failure in U.S. history.
